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on current industry data, the South Korean FDY yarn market was valued at approximately USD 1.2 billion

in 2023. This valuation accounts for domestic manufacturing, exports, and import dependencies, with a significant portion attributable to high-quality, specialty FDY products used in technical textiles and fashion segments.

Assuming a conservative comp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.2%

over the next five years, driven by rising demand for lightweight, durable, and eco-friendly textiles, the market is projected to reach approximately USD 1.58 billion

by 2028. Extending the outlook to 10 years, with an estimated CAGR of 4.8%, the market could approach USD 1.9 billion

by 2033, contingent upon technological adoption and regional trade dynamics.

Value Chain and Revenue Models

The value chain encompasses:

  1. Raw Material Sourcing:

    Petrochemical derivatives (PET, PTA) and recycled polymers constitute approximately 60% of raw costs. Strategic partnerships with raw material suppliers are vital for cost control.

  2. Manufacturing & Processing:

    Investment in high-efficiency melt spinning lines, texturizing, and finishing equipment enables differentiation. Revenue is generated through direct yarn sales, licensing of proprietary technologies, and custom formulations.

  3. Distribution & Logistics:

    Distribution channels include regional warehouses, export agents, and online platforms. Margins are influenced by logistics efficiency and trade tariffs.

  4. End-User Delivery & Lifecycle Services:

    Value-added services such as technical support, quality assurance, and recycling programs enhance customer retention and enable circular economy models.

The lifecycle of FDY yarn involves continuous R&D, quality upgrades, and after-sales support, with revenue streams diversified across product sales, licensing, and service contracts.

Cost Structures, Pricing Strategies, and Investment Patterns

Key insights include:

  • Cost Structures:

    Raw materials account for approximately 50-60% of production costs; energy consumption and labor are secondary factors.

  • Pricing Strategies:

    Premium pricing is prevalent for specialty, eco-friendly, and technical FDY yarns, while commodity grades compete primarily on cost.

  • Capital Investment Patterns:

    Modernization of spinning lines (~USD 10–15 million per line) is common, with a focus on automation and sustainability upgrades.

  • Operating Margins:

    Typically range between 8–12%, with higher margins for niche, high-performance products.

Adoption Trends & Use Cases in Major End-User Segments

Key observations include:

  • Fashion & Apparel:

    Growing demand for lightweight, moisture-wicking, and sustainable FDY yarns in athleisure and fast fashion segments.

  • Technical Textiles:

    Automotive interior fabrics, filtration media, and medical textiles are expanding markets for high-performance FDY fibers.

  • Home Textiles:

    Use in upholstery, curtains, and bedding with emphasis on durability and eco-friendliness.

Shifting consumption patterns favor premium, functional, and eco-conscious products, with digital platforms enabling direct-to-consumer sales and customization.

Competitive Landscape & Strategic Focus Areas

Major players include:

  • Hyosung Corporation:

    Focus on high-performance and eco-friendly fibers, strategic R&D investments, and global expansion.

  • SK Chemicals:

    Innovating in bio-based polymers and sustainable fibers, emphasizing circular economy initiatives.

  • LG Chem:

    Leveraging advanced polymer technology for premium FDY products and cross-industry collaborations.

  • Regional & Niche Players:

    Smaller firms focusing on specialty fibers, customization, and rapid innovation cycles.
